Final Mitigated Negative Declaration 

The SANDAG Board of Directors adopted the Addendum to the Final Mitigated Negative Declaration for the San Marcos to Vista Segment of the Inland Rail Trail at its September 26, 2014 meeting. The project received approval under the national Environmental Policy Act (NEPA) on August 28, 2014.

The SANDAG Board of Directors adopted the Final Subsequent Mitigated Negative Declaration for the San Marcos to Vista Segment of the Inland Rail Trail at its July 26, 2013 meeting. The project received approval under the National Environmental Policy Act (NEPA) on August 5, 2013.
